Dietitian noteHigh-fat dairy products can relax the lower esophageal sphincter (LES), the muscle that separates the esophagus from the stomach. This can allow stomach acid to flow back into the esophagus, leading to heartburn.

Ingredients
Water, Monterey Jack Cheese (milk, Cheese Cultures, Salt, Enzymes), Soybean Oil, Maltodextrin, Jalapeno Peppers, Modified Corn Starch, Red Bell Peppers, Whey Protein Concentrate, Contains Less Than 2% Of. Green Chiles, Salt, Diced Tomatoes In Juice (diced Tomatoes, Tomato Juice, Citric Acid [to Acidify], Calcium Chloride Firming), Sodium Phosphate, Enzyme Modified Cheese (cheddar Cheese [pasteurized Milk, Cheese Culture, Salt, Enzyme], Cream, Natural Flavor, Salt, Mono And Diglycerides, Sodium Phosphate, Enzymes), Natural Flavor, Datem, Sodium Citrate (preservative), Lactic Acid, Vinegar, Sodium Alginate, Sorbic Acid (preservative), Xanthan Gum, Monosodium Glutamate, Artificial Color (yellow 5 And Yellow 6). Contains: Milk.
